Detecting AI-written content can be challenging, as AI technology has advanced to the point where it can sometimes produce very human-like writing. However, there are a few indicators that can help you identify AI-generated content:
1. Unnatural language: AI-written content may contain unusual phrasing, awkward sentence structures, or grammatical errors that humans are less likely to make.
2. Lack of personal voice: AI-written content often lacks the personal voice and unique perspective that human writers bring to their work.
3. Repetitive patterns: AI-generated content may exhibit repetitive patterns or phrases that are consistent throughout the text.
4. Lack of depth or originality: AI-written content may lack depth or originality, as it is programmed to produce text based on pre-existing data or templates.
5. Inconsistencies: AI-generated content may contain inconsistencies or contradictions that a human writer would be less likely to include.
While these indicators can help you identify AI-written content, it is important to note that AI technology is constantly improving, and it may become more difficult to distinguish between human and AI-generated content in the future.
